+#ifdef CONFIG_LIVEPATCH
+/*
+ * copy_module_elf - preserve Elf information about a module
+ *
+ * Copy relevant Elf information from the load_info struct.
+ * Note: not all fields from the original load_info are
+ * copied into mod->info.
This makes me nervous, to have a struct which is half-initialized.

Better would be to have a separate type for this, eg:

struct livepatch_modinfo {
        Elf_Ehdr hdr;
        Elf_Shdr *sechdrs;
        char *secstrings;
        /* FIXME: Which of these do you need? */
        struct {
        	unsigned int sym, str, mod, vers, info, pcpu;
        } index;
};

This also avoids an extra allocation as hdr is no longer a ptr.
+	/*
+	 * Update symtab's sh_addr to point to a valid
+	 * symbol table, as the temporary symtab in module
+	 * init memory will be freed
+	 */
+	mod->info->sechdrs[mod->info->index.sym].sh_addr = (unsigned long)mod->core_symtab;
This comment is a bit misleading: it's actually pointing into the
temporary module copy, which will be discarded.  The init section is
slightly different...
+#ifdef CONFIG_LIVEPATCH
+static int check_livepatch_modinfo(struct module *mod, struct load_info *info)
+{
+	mod->klp = get_modinfo(info, "livepatch") ? true : false;
+
+	return 0;
+}
+#else
+static int check_livepatch_modinfo(struct module *mod, struct load_info *info)
+{
+	if (get_modinfo(info, "livepatch"))
+		return -EINVAL;
+
+	return 0;
+}
+#endif
The term "check" implies no side-effects; I'd usually call this
int find_livepatch_modinfo(), and make sure you use the error code in
the caller:
+	err = check_livepatch_modinfo(mod, info);
+	if (err)
+		return -ENOEXEC;
